Sound Clips: Coryton Refinery Siren and Sunday Service by Ian Rawes of The London Sound Survey

Canvey Island is an industrial district in the Thames Estuary, down-river from London. The western half of the island is overshadowed by an oil refinery, the eastern half is given over to housing. These two sound recordings from Canvey Island show this contrast. Sirens mounted on liquified gas holders emit strange whale-like sounds as they undergo regular weekend testing. Further east, along the riverfront, worshippers from the island’s small Caribbean community hold an outdoor Sunday service on a bandstand.
